Output 75d61778276c593b083498f89b64460296cb751b6f02e7997c68cdd83119a7b4:2

value
9850000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c9a37b41ac41b6a1cd73b5e7d459778a64d60649 OP_EQUAL
address
3L5Baza3HfeH7QQtLpvSyExni8gVN4dJip
transaction
75d61778276c593b083498f89b64460296cb751b6f02e7997c68cdd83119a7b4
spent
true